質問編集履歴
2
タイトルと本文を一部修正
test
CHANGED
@@ -1 +1 @@
|
|
1
|
-
【Mac】【VSCode】デバッグコンソールでマルチバイトな文字列を正しく出力させたい【環境構築】
|
1
|
+
【Mac】【VSCode】デバッグコンソール上でマルチバイトな文字列を正しく出力させたい【C/C++】【環境構築】
|
test
CHANGED
@@ -69,7 +69,7 @@
|
|
69
69
|
```
|
70
70
|
xe3x81x93xe3x82x93xe3x81xabxe3x81xa1xe3x81xaf
|
71
71
|
```
|
72
|
-
の部分で、このように文字化け...と言いますか、16進数の羅列みたいな感じで表示されます。この時[ターミナル]パネルの方は、以下のようになっています。
|
72
|
+
の部分で、このように文字化け...と言いますか、16進数の羅列みたいな感じで表示されてしまいます。この時[ターミナル]パネルの方は、以下のようになっています。
|
73
73
|
```
|
74
74
|
> Executing task: C/C++: gcc-11 アクティブなファイルのビルド <
|
75
75
|
|
1
英字の場合の出力を含めた表示を追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-224,6 +224,21 @@
|
|
224
224
|
}
|
225
225
|
```
|
226
226
|
|
227
|
+
### 追記
|
228
|
+
以下のように、英字の場合は正しく出力されます。
|
229
|
+
```C
|
230
|
+
// ファイル名:test.c
|
231
|
+
|
232
|
+
#include <stdio.h>
|
233
|
+
|
234
|
+
int main(){
|
235
|
+
printf("Hello\n");
|
236
|
+
printf("こんにちは\n");
|
237
|
+
return 0;
|
238
|
+
}
|
239
|
+
```
|
240
|
+
![英語と日本語でそれぞれ挨拶プログラム](https://ddjkaamml8q8x.cloudfront.net/questions/2022-06-11/e199a838-4a64-40ce-9978-580463d5a730.png)
|
241
|
+
|
227
242
|
---
|
228
243
|
|
229
244
|
以上です。よろしくお願いいたします。
|